Adarian is a modern elaboration of Adrian, which originates from the Latin name Hadrianus, meaning 'from Hadria.' Hadria was a town in Northern Italy that gave its name to the Adriatic Sea. It is also sometimes associated with the Persian name Adar, meaning 'fire.'

Adarian isn't in the latest US Top 1000. It last peaked at #5,999 in 2006.
